SARRUBBA | SARRUBBI | SARRUBBO | SARUBBI | SARUBBO

Sarrubba, Sarrubbi and Sarrubbo, very very rare, they are Neapolitan, Sarubbi is specific to the area of Lucano, Cosentina, Lauria, Francavilla in Sinni and Latronico in Potentino, Stigliano, San Giorgio Lucano and Matera in the Matera and Verbicaro, Santa Maria del Cedro , Orsomarso, Francavilla Marittima and Scalea in Cosentino, Sarubbo, much less widespread, is specific to the Ionian, Tortora and Praia a Mare in the Cosentino, for these surnames there are two types of hypothesis, the first is that they can derive from altered apheretic forms of Nicknames originated from the term Casa Rubia (Red House), perhaps to indicate a characteristic of the dwelling of the ancestor, the second hypothesis, the most likely, proposes a derivation from the Arabic name Sharrub or Sharub, name that derives from the Arabic word that has originated our word syrup.

Bibliographic source "L'origine dei cognomi Italianim storia ed etimologia" di E. Rossoni disponibile online su: https://archive.org/
